Using the Programmer

The Rocker Switch on the side of the unit is used to select how your 102
controls your hot water & heating system. You can manually select either:

hot water only (Fig.4)
hot water & heating together

 

(Fig.5)

neither, system OFF (Fig.5)

The 102 unit is now set, and the current status of the timeswitch can be
seen on the wheel at the top righthand corner of the unit, (e.g. “OFF
UNTIL C”). Fig.6

User Overrides

The pre-selector wheel can be used to override the set programme on
occasions when you need to change from your normal heating routine.

By turning the wheel 

anti-clockwise

 you can turn the unit ON when it

is OFF and vice versa (Fig.7).

Example:

Your programme is set so that your heating comes on at 4pm but
you arrive home earlier than usual, at 2pm and need the heating ON
immediately.
Turn the wheel anti-clockwise until it displays ON UNTIL ‘D’ as
shown.
Thus the system is turned ON manually at 2pm but will revert to the
set programme at the next operation (i.e. OFF at 11pm)

Some other useful pre-selections are:

ALL DAY ON (1 ON/1 OFF)

Turn the Wheel to display “ON UNTIL D”.

ALL DAY OFF

Turn the Wheel to display “OFF UNTIL A”.

Note: Do not operate the pre-selector whilst a tappet is close to the

TIME mark. This may cause the time of day setting of the clock
to be altered, and the time would then need to be reset..
